Backup merge ?

Post by nicolasross »

I have an agent backup of my home computer to my NAS. Recently I have re-installed from scratch and made a new backup job. So I have an "old" backup of my computer with many restore points. This "old" backup folded is then not attached to any job on my computer. Is there a way to merge all restore point into a single restore point, as I do not need anymore all that restore point, but only the last one.

Re: Backup merge ?

Post by HannesK »

Hello,
"map backup" is the way to continue an existing backup chain: https://helpcenter.veeam.com/docs/agent ... backup-job

But that doesn't work for you, because you have two independent chains now. In that situation, you need to manually delete the old backup chain once it is outdated.
